AT29BV010A-12TI utilizes Flash memory technology. It stores data by trapping electric charges within floating gate transistors. These charges represent binary values (0 or 1). The presence or absence of charge determines the stored data. Reading involves sensing the charge level, while writing and erasing involve applying appropriate voltage levels to modify the charge state.

Q: What is the AT29BV010A-12TI? A: The AT29BV010A-12TI is a 1-megabit (128K x 8) CMOS flash memory chip manufactured by Atmel.
Q: What is the operating voltage range for this chip? A: The AT29BV010A-12TI operates within a voltage range of 2.7V to 3.6V.
